Information requested

Information on the PEDL 162 licence: if it was granted over the period of 20/21.

Response

The answer to your question is that the initial term of PEDL 162 expired on 30 June 2020 and was not extended. The licence was revoked with effect from 1 July 2020. Information about the licences held in Scotland following devolution of onshore oil and gas licensing powers in February 2018 (including PEDL 162) is available on the Marine Scotland website.
